How we run pools for country clubs & private clubs

Country club operations are high-touch. The aquatics director reports into the club GM, who reports to a member board, and member feedback moves fast. We staff country clubs with leads who understand multi-pool complexes, lifeguard rotation math, swim-team practice schedules, private-event turnover, and when a concern should be escalated as an operational issue.

Country clubs typically run several aquatic areas: main pool, zero-entry family pool, kids wading pool, and sometimes a splash pad or spa. The amenity standard is high, and full lifeguard staffing is expected.

What country clubs & private clubs actually struggle with

Common operating issues for country clubs boards and managers

Lifeguard retention collapses in August as college staff return to campus

Aqua-Guard response: Our hiring pipeline runs year-round, and August staffing risk is planned early so departures can be addressed before the late-season schedule is exposed.

Member-board expectations drift with every new incoming club president

Aqua-Guard response: We run an annual aquatics review with your incoming board cycle so expectations are set before summer.

Private events overlap with normal pool operations

Aqua-Guard response: Our staffing plan includes event-float lifeguards who can cover private events without pulling guards off the main deck.

Illinois compliance reality for country clubs & private clubs

Private country club pools in Illinois are still semi-public facilities under 77 Ill. Adm. Code 820 because they serve more than one household. Health department inspections are no different from an HOA pool. IDPH can visit, pull logs, and close the facility. We treat the compliance surface identically.
